Exegesis

The relative clause asher-yishkav {אֲשֶׁר־יִשְׁכַּב | ʾăšer yiškav} qualifies “a man,” framing the sexual act as a conditional action.

In contextLeviticus 20:18

And if a man lies with a woman who is menstruating, and he uncovers her nakedness, he has exposed her source, and she has uncovered the source of her blood. Both of them shall be cut off from among their people.

About this coordinate

Leviticus 20:18:2 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 2 of Leviticus 20:18, so the Hebrew word אֲשֶׁר־יִשְׁכַּ֨ב (asheryishkav)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Lev.20.18.W2, which extends further down to each syllable (Lev.20.18.W2.S1) and character.
